After brunch at a local resturant, it's on to The Huntington Library, Art Museum and Botanical Gardens in San Marino for an expertly guided tour of this collections-based educational and research institution. Surrounded by 120 acres spread across 12 specialized gardens, the property was originally the private estate of railroad magnate Henry Huntington, and today is one of Southern California's must-see cultural destinations. Its magnificent collections of rare books, manuscripts, and famous works of art include Gainsborough's The Blue Boy, Mary Cassatt's Breakfast in Bed, a Gutenberg Bible, an illuminated manuscript of Chaucer's The Canterbury Tales, a First Folio edition of Shakespeare and more. The Library houses more than 11 million items spanning the 11th to the 21st century. The Art Museum features British, European, American, and Asian art spanning more than 500 years and includes more than 45,000 objects. And the Botanical Gardens dazzle with 16 stunning themed gardens with more than 83,000 living plants, including rare and endangered species, and a laboratory for botanical conservation and research. Pioneers of Hollywood's film industry in the 1920s, the Warner brothers were four young men with stars in their eyes and big dreams in their hearts. While the world was smitten with the silent black and white films that were all the rage back then, the Warner brothers wanted to makes movies that spoke to their audiences even more, gambling on adding color and voices to the stories they showcased on the big screen. Their dreams paid off in 1927 when their first talking picture, The Jazz Singer featuring Al Jolson, was made. At the time The Jazz Singer consisted mostly of music with only a couple of hundred spoken words but it was an immediate success. By 1930, 40% of the nation's cinemas had sound systems installed. Movie stars such as Rudolph Valentino, Clara Bow, John Barrymore, Mary Astor, Charlie Chaplin, Mary Pickford, Douglas Fairbanks and Greta Garbo found the spotlight, enchanting millions of movie goers with their acting charms. Discover a uniquely American tradition more than a century old today, when members of a distinguished hunt club in Pasadena invited their former neighbors from the East Coast to a New Year's holiday that included a parade of flower-decked carriages and competitive games under the warm California sun. The earliest Tournament of Roses welcomed 3,000 spectators to its first parade filled with beautiful, horse-drawn carriages covered in flowers. More than a century later, the parade floats are a marvel of state-of-the-art technology, all tucked away beneath flowers and other all-natural materials. The festival bloomed as the years went by, and today the Tournament of Roses® has become synonymous with the imaginatively decorated floats of the Rose Parade® floats - as well as the annual Rose Bowl Game®.
